Full description
Original leaf sculpture: Woven kaleidoscopic leaf pane made with leaves and thorns, in between two pieces of circular perspex in handmade wooden frame.
One of a kind titled: "Kaleidoscopic Leaf Pane (Square Escher Tessellation Pattern One)"
- Size 90 x 90 cm
Each side is different and it can be displayed with either side showing, or illuminated from behind to reveal the complex kaleidoscopic patterns. Each sculpture is unique due to the materials and variations in patterns used.
Here it is shown displayed on a cabinet top in two configurations: square and diagonal. It is shown in natural light and also illuminated from behind by an LED ceiling light fixed to the wall (that can be lit with daylight, warm light or mixed illumination). The LED light is not included and this is a suggestion for how the sculpture can be enjoyed.

Made with foraged leaves and thorns. Leaves have been dried and not treated with any chemical treatments. Leaf colours may change over time. Leaves kept out of excessive UV and moisture last for many years.
I have many leaf objects, made over 20 years ago, from the beginning of my art career that are still completely intact, that were not treated and only dried. But as this an object made from natural materials no guarantees can be given about its longevity.
